About Weston Heath

Weston Heath is a small village located in Shropshire, England, within the postcode area TF11. The village is surrounded by the natural beauty of the Shropshire countryside, offering a peaceful environment for residents and visitors alike. The area is characterised by its rural landscape, which includes fields and woodlands, making it suitable for leisurely walks and outdoor activities. Local amenities in Weston Heath are limited, but nearby towns provide essential services and facilities. The village is well-connected to the surrounding areas, allowing easy access to larger towns for shopping and dining. Weston Heath serves as a quiet retreat for those looking to escape the busyness of urban life while still being within reach of local attractions and the scenic Shropshire countryside.
